Travel Radio as a form of struggle: scenes from late colonial Angola – By mylusoJanuary 18, 2025Less 1 min read The Portuguese colonisers were not the only ones who could use radio for control. A new book tells how popular radio broadcasts from Angola’s liberation fighters were used as weapons in the struggle.
